List of fire-retardant materials - Wikipedia

Fire-retardant materials should not be confused with fire-resistant materials. A fire resistant material is one that is designed to resist burning and withstand heat, however, fire-retardant materials are designed to burn slowly. An example of a fire-resistant material is one which is used in bunker gear worn by firefighters to...

TLC for FRC: Caring for Flame Resistant Clothing at Home

Mar 10, 2016 ... There are four major types of FR fabrics: inherently FR fibers, treated fabrics, treated fibers and blends. Again, each type ... Users of FR garments should consult the ASTM International Standard F 2757, which lays out the standards for care and maintenance of flame resistant clothing. Your FR clothing is...
